Ticket: Crashfall ingest failing on staging

New folks, please read carefully. The Pebblekit mobile app's crash reports aren't reaching the symbolication queue because staging's env file was copied without its upload credential. Symptoms: 401s in the collector logs every five minutes. To fix, add the missing line to the env file, exactly as follows.

secret setting of fafop-tagep: VAULT_KEY29=6a815d21e2d77cc25ef1802d73ee6

Hi — quick note before tomorrow's DR drill at Quillhaven. The events table is partitioned by month, so restore only the last two partitions to keep the window short. Review the restore script with that in mind. The drill backup bundle is encrypted; unlock it with the passphrase listed below.

unlock words, hahip-yagef: zorok-novmir-zorix-silax

## Deployment

Formulary evaluates user-supplied formulas inside a seccomp-restricted worker pool. Each worker gets a 50 ms CPU budget and 16 MB heap; anything exceeding limits is killed and logged, not retried. Deploy the sandbox image alongside the API — never in-process. For Thursday's sync: rollout is canary-first, two regions. The sandbox workers start with the following configuration.

service settings:
PRAIX_LOG_LEVEL=error
PRAIX_METRICS_HOST=metrics.praix.qorvelcorp.corp
PRAIX_POOL_SIZE=16

This repo contains the Cratesort pick-list optimizer used by the Harrowfield warehouse network. It batches orders, sequences bin visits, and emits routes to handheld scanners. Do not change the scoring weights in `heuristics/` without a benchmark run; throughput regressions here cost real shifts. Contractors get read access by default; write access requires onboarding review. Deploys go through the Cratesort pipeline only — no manual pushes. For scope questions, escalations, or merge approval, contact the service owner named below.

account owner for bawip-tahag: Raleth Quenok

Quick context on the Crumbline order-cutoff rule: orders placed after the cutoff roll to the next bake day, except for the Marzano Street location, which gets an extended window. Don't hardcode times in the handlers; everything reads from the cutoff module. The current tuning constants are listed below.

tuning constants:
QUOTAS = {
    "druwyn": 5,
    "holix": 5,
    "zorath": 5,
    "holwyn": 10,
}